Loading...

Articles

BLOG

Humanoid Robots Are Coming of Age

[photo1]Will KnightEight years ago, the Pentagon's Defense Advanced Research Projects Agency organized a painful-to-watch contest that involved robots slowly struggling (and often failing) to perform ...

May 2023
BLOG

How to Tell If You Have Lead Pipes

Although the law banning the installation of lead pipes in the United States took effect in 1988, that still leaves many homes across the country with plumbing that may contain lead. So, how can you d...

May 2023
Top